User’s Manual of IGS-10020HPT

Retry Count (1~5)

This column allows user to set how many times system rerry ping to PD. For

example, if we set count 2, the meaning is that if system retry ping to the PD and the

PD doesn’t response continuously, the PoE port will be reset.

Action

Allows user to set which action will be apply if the PD witout any response.

IGS-10020HPT PoE Switch offers 3 actions as following.

PD Reboot: It menas system will reset the PoE port that connected the PD.

Reboot & Alarm: It means system will reset the PoE port and issue an alarm

message via Syslog, SMTP.

Alarm: It means system will issue an alarm message via Syslog, SMTP.

Reboot Time (30~180s)

This column allows user to set the PoE device rebooting time, due to there are so

many kind of PoE device on the market and theyhave different rebooting time. The

PD Alive-check is not a defining standard, so the PoE device on the market doesn’t

report reboots done information to IGS-10020HPT PoE Switch, so user has to make

sure how long the PD will be finished to boot, and then set the time value to this

column.

System is going to check the PD again according to the reboot time. If ou can not

make sure precisely booting time, we suggest you to set it longer.
